The candid position is that corporate metaverse projects from the peak of the hype largely stand empty — the ones still running serve a defined community with a reason to gather, and that reason has to exist before the space is built.

Do corporate metaverse projects work?
Rarely as built during the hype. Branded spaces without a reason to gather attracted a launch audience and then emptied. The ones that persist serve an existing community — a game, a course, a professional group — where people already had a reason to be together.
Should it require a headset?
No, if you want an audience. Headset ownership is a fraction of any general population, and requiring one removes most of the people you were trying to reach. Browser-accessible spaces reach far more, at some cost to immersion.
What is the hardest part?
Sustained attendance. Building the environment is a known quantity; giving people a reason to come back next month is the actual problem, and it is a community and programming question rather than a technical one.
What about safety in shared spaces?
It needs designing in. Harassment in virtual spaces is a documented problem, and any environment where people interact needs moderation tools, reporting and enforcement from launch. Where children may access it, the obligations are considerably heavier.
